FAANG Employees Struggling to Leave High Compensation Despite FIRE Goals
High-earning employees at large tech companies who have reached financial independence find it psychologically and financially difficult to leave due to ongoing compensation structures like unvested equity. This is a personal career decision dilemma rather than a software-solvable problem. The question is seeking peer advice and lived experience, not a product or tool.
